  • The Family Engagement Management License (ML) program is aa competency based curriculum program that is used to develop and enhance the family support skills related to the critical job functions of staff working with families. Participants learn skills that they can perform with an optimal level of proficiency and competence. The Family Engagement Supervisor Credential will follow a specific series of steps beginning with what your program goals for family support and how to incorporate ethics into your program goals in family-staff relationships, continuing through communication with families by using hypothetical case files and managing those hypothetical cases.  The License credential will incorporate discussions about service plans and the dynamics of a family’s situation. Students learn more about collaboration and to increase your ability to participate in the same sort of discussions in the programs where you work. Participants must complete three (3) courses, two (2) exams and a student practicum. After classroom and practicum is finished, a portfolio of work education and training packet must be completed and submitted to the University. Once documents, coursework, fieldwork and exams are complete and submitted to Student Advisor, an assessment date for licensing is set.  Upon the completion of HS University's family engagement credential orlicense, your Courses approved for NASW CEU's!credential/license will be based on the NationalAssociation of Social Workers (NASW) continuing education requirements and the Council on Social Work Education (CSWE) educational standards. HS University's Family Engagement credential/license program also aligns with Head Start Program Performance Standards (HSPPS) relationship-based competencies. Transfer Credits

Candidates who has previously received a Family Development Credential or Social Service Credential can transfer to the Family Engagment Administrative Credential if they complete a Prior Learning Assessment form (PLA), Candidate Application Form, and complete the FE Core Course #1(3 weeks online). There is a $495 program application fee.
